CW 501P Mentorship Semester I Poetry

Prerequisite: CW 500A
Along with the residency experience, close literary mentorship is a hallmark of the Low-Residency MFA in Creative Writing. Under the guidance of a mentor, students will develop a reading list and write original poetry and critical essays, with page counts and schedule to be mutually determined by the mentor and student. The mentor will provide substantial feedback, including suggestions for reading and revision. This course is taken during the first semester.
